Key Features
- 2-in-1 Lens System: The detachable wide-angle lens converts to a 40mm macro so users can quickly switch from broad vistas to detailed close-ups without extra gear.
- Anamorphic 1.1x: The included anamorphic lens gives footage a cinematic aspect ratio and characteristic lens flares for more film-like video.
- Comprehensive ND Filters: The ND8, ND32, and ND128 filters let shooters control exposure across bright conditions and achieve motion blur or shallower depth of field.
- Magnetic Mounting: The magnetic lens and filter system makes attachment and removal fast and straightforward for run-and-gun shooting situations.
- Featherweight Design: Individual elements are very light (macro 3.2 g, anamorphic 5.6 g, wide+macro 6.5 g, ND filter 1 g), keeping the Pocket 3 balanced and portable.
Who It's For
The kit suits mobile filmmakers, travel photographers, and content creators using the Pocket 3 who want a single compact solution for both wide landscapes and macro detail. It is especially useful for those who value cinematic touches like anamorphic flares and an expanded aspect ratio without adding bulky gear.
It is less appropriate for photographers who require full-frame optical control, heavy-duty pro cinema rigs, or those who need very strong magnetic mounts for extreme action use; a rig with locking lens mounts would be a better fit for high-impact sports capture.

Specifications
| Compatible Model | Pocket 3 |
| Lens Types | Wide 0.9x, Macro 40mm, Anamorphic 1.1x |
| Included ND Filters | ND8, ND32, ND128 |
| Weight (macro) | 3.2 g |
| Weight (anamorphic) | 5.6 g |
| Weight (wide+macro) | 6.5 g |
| Weight (ND filter) | 1 g |
